Our client, a well-established wealth management firm with a robust in-house tax practice stemming from a large CPA firm acquisition, is seeking an experienced Staff Accountant to join their professional team. This position is ideal for a hands-on accounting professional who thrives in a production-focused environment and enjoys managing multiple client engagements with precision and autonomy.
The Staff Accountant plays a key role in managing monthly client accounting engagements from start to finish. This is a plug-and-play opportunity for an experienced professional who can independently own the monthly close process, including reconciliations, journal entries, and financial statement preparation.
The ideal candidate has experience working within the tax/accounting space and supporting professional service businesses such as legal or medical practices.
Manage a portfolio of monthly bookkeeping and accounting clients (up to 15–20 at capacity over time).
Take each client engagement from start to finish on a monthly basis.
Perform full-cycle accounting, including transaction coding, bank and credit card reconciliations, and general ledger maintenance.
Prepare and post adjusting journal entries and support month-end close processes.
Prepare and finalize monthly financial statements.
Review work when applicable and ensure accuracy of account classifications and reporting.
Communicate with clients as needed to gather documentation and clarify transactions (initially limited client-facing responsibility).
Utilize QuickBooks Desktop and QuickBooks Online extensively as a power user.
5–7 years of accounting/bookkeeping experience, preferably within a tax, public accounting, or client accounting services environment.
Experience working with professional service firms such as legal or medical practices preferred.
Strong understanding of general ledger accounting, reconciliations, adjusting journal entries, and financial statement preparation.
Advanced proficiency in QuickBooks Desktop and QuickBooks Online required (power user level).
Strong organizational skills with the ability to manage multiple client deadlines.
